Compare all specifications:
2007 Hyundai Elantra | 2000 Jeep Wrangler | |
Make | Hyundai | Jeep |
Model | Elantra | Wrangler |
Year Released | 2007 | 2000 |
Body Type | Sedan |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1989 cc | 2464 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 111 HP | 123 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 5300 RPM |
Torque | 235 Nm | 193 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 2900 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 83 mm | 98.3 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 92 mm | 81 mm |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1188 kg | 1395 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4530 mm | 3890 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1730 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1790 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2620 mm | 2380 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 57 L |
